Carcinogenesis ; 17(3): 493-9, 1996 Mar.
Artigo em Inglês | MEDLINE | ID: mdl-8631135

RESUMO

The effect of prolonged consumption of a vitamin-antioxidant mixture (VAM) on the frequency of spontaneous and in vitro gamma-radiation-induced micronuclei (MN) in peripheral blood lymphocytes in donors of various ages was investigated. Three groups of donors were recruited: (i) 56-83 years old (35 subjects), (ii) 23-30 years old (13 subjects), and (iii) 63-82 years old (12 subjects). Blood was sampled every 4 months for one year in all donors of the three groups. After the first sampling of blood, the donors of groups (i) and (ii) took VAM containing the vitamins A, C, E, as well as beta-carotene, folic acid, and rutin daily for 4 months. After the second blood sampling, the intake of VAM was terminated. The third blood sample was taken 4 months after termination of VAM intake. A part of the blood was exposed to gamma-radiation and the frequency of spontaneous and induced MN in lymphocytes was assayed. The analyses showed that the frequency of spontaneous and in vitro gamma-ray-induced MN in aged donors was significantly higher than that in young donors. No seasonal variations in MN frequency were observed in human lymphocytes during one year. Aged donors showed a statistically significant decrease in spontaneous MN in lymphocytes after a 4 month period of consumption of VAM. The intake of VAM by both aged and young donors promoted a decrease in MN induced lymphocytes in vitro by gamma-radiation. The results of our observations enable the suggestion that consumption of VAM favours a decrease in the chromosome damage produced by endogenous and exogenous factors in human lymphocytes.

Patol Fiziol Eksp Ter ; (2): 19-23, 1991.
Artigo em Russo | MEDLINE | ID: mdl-1881700

RESUMO

Experiments were conducted on animals with chronically implanted electrodes in the brain to study the frequency composition of its electrical activity in normovolemic replacement of blood with a carbon pertetrafluoride emulsion "Perftoran" (11 rats), and in plethoric intravenous (7 rabbits) and intracerebral (5 rats) injections of this preparation. Marked reactions were encountered in the initial period after Perftoran administration (up to 4-8 hours in transfusions and 0-5 minutes in intravascular and intracerebral infusions).

Biokhimiia ; 50(7): 1220-7, 1985 Jul.
Artigo em Russo | MEDLINE | ID: mdl-4041497

RESUMO

Intravenous injections of perfluoroorganic emulsions to rats in a dose of 3 ml/kg led to changes in the composition and activity of enzymes of the liver microsomal membrane monooxygenase system. At the peak of induction, i. e., on the 3rd post-injection day, the levels of microsomal cytochromes P-450 and b5 increased 2.8- and 1.9-fold, respectively, as compared to the control. Simultaneously, the rate of NADPH oxidation in the microsomes and the rate of hydroxylation of substrates I and II showed an increase. Conversely, the rate of NADPH-dependent peroxidation of microsomal lipids on the 2nd-4th post-injection days reached its minimal values. These injections stimulated the detoxicating function of rat liver as evidenced from the duration of the hexenal sleep of the animals. All the changes in the monooxygenase system parameters were temporary and reached the control level on the 10th-14th days after injection. It was demonstrated that the main component of the perfluoroorganic emulsions, perfluorodecalin, was responsible for the induction of the monooxygenase system enzymes.
